Logo video2dn
  • Сохранить видео с ютуба
  • Категории
    • Музыка
    • Кино и Анимация
    • Автомобили
    • Животные
    • Спорт
    • Путешествия
    • Игры
    • Люди и Блоги
    • Юмор
    • Развлечения
    • Новости и Политика
    • Howto и Стиль
    • Diy своими руками
    • Образование
    • Наука и Технологии
    • Некоммерческие Организации
  • О сайте

Скачать или смотреть Course preview: Getting started with PetaLinux

  • VHDLwhiz.com
  • 2025-02-06
  • 915
Course preview: Getting started with PetaLinux
  • ok logo

Скачать Course preview: Getting started with PetaLinux бесплатно в качестве 4к (2к / 1080p)

У нас вы можете скачать бесплатно Course preview: Getting started with PetaLinux или посмотреть видео с ютуба в максимальном доступном качестве.

Для скачивания выберите вариант из формы ниже:

  • Информация по загрузке:

Cкачать музыку Course preview: Getting started with PetaLinux бесплатно в формате MP3:

Если иконки загрузки не отобразились, ПОЖАЛУЙСТА, НАЖМИТЕ ЗДЕСЬ или обновите страницу
Если у вас возникли трудности с загрузкой, пожалуйста, свяжитесь с нами по контактам, указанным в нижней части страницы.
Спасибо за использование сервиса video2dn.com

Описание к видео Course preview: Getting started with PetaLinux

This is a preview of the "Getting started with PetaLinux" VHDLwhiz course.

Click here to read more and see how to access this course:
https://vhdlwhiz.com/product/course-g...

PetaLinux is a Linux distro AMD Xilinx maintains specifically for their devices. It can run on soft-core MicroBlaze processors or the Zynq-7000 series FPGAs with hard ARM CPU cores. This course focuses on the latter, although most of the process is identical for MicroBlaze.

It’s easy to get overwhelmed by PetaLinux as it involves many components and tools. Therefore, I’ve made this step-by-step tutorial to give you the skills you need to succeed on your own.

You will also learn to customize PetaLinux, install software and device drivers, and develop and debug C applications that interact with your VHDL modules.

** Lessons included in the course:

1 - Introduction
Welcome to the course! Here's what we'll do and what you will learn from the lessons.

2 - Install Linux virtual machine
The easiest way to work with PetaLinux in Windows is to use the free VMware software to create a Ubuntu Linux virtual machine and install the Xilinx tools there.

3 - Install Vivado in Linux
Vivado works well in Ubuntu even though Xilinx AMD doesn't officially support it. I'll walk you through the installation and create the first block design with a ZYNQ7 Processing System.

4 - Install PetaLinux Tools and dependencies
This video shows how to download, install, and configure PetaLinux Tools on Ubuntu. We'll also install a TFTP server and the Minicom serial communication program.

5 - First PetaLinux build + TFTP boot
Let's export the hardware from Vivado to PetaLinux Tools, build it, and start it on the FPGA board using the TFTP Ethernet boot method.

6 - SD card boot
Booting from an SD card is also an option. You must manually copy the BOOT.BIN and other files to the card, but an advantage is that changes made to the root filesystem persist after rebooting.

7 - Configuring PetaLinux
Don't let the PetaLinux Tools commands confuse you! Watch this video to learn how to use the config menus and understand how PetaLinux works under the hood.

8 - The Xilinx AXI GPIO IP
We'll add a Xilinx GPIO to our second Vivado block design, and I'll show you how to control it easily from PetaLinux using the userspace /sys/class/gpio Sysfs interface.

9 - Creating a custom AXI4-Lite VHDL module
Learn to create IP modules in Vivado containing your custom VHDL code. With Vivado's IP Packager, we'll make an AXI4-Lite slave module and access its registers from PetaLinux.

10 - Remote debugging PetaLinux C programs in VSCode
You can debug C apps running in PetaLinux using GDB and gdbserver to step through the code and show variable values in the VSCode editor on Ubuntu.

Комментарии

Информация по комментариям в разработке

Похожие видео

  • О нас
  • Контакты
  • Отказ от ответственности - Disclaimer
  • Условия использования сайта - TOS
  • Политика конфиденциальности

video2dn Copyright © 2023 - 2025

Контакты для правообладателей [email protected]